Choctaw Nation sets grand opening for $60M casino expansion

The Choctaw Nation of Oklahoma is hosting a grand opening this Saturday for a $60 million casino expansion project.

The Choctaw Casino in Pocola is getting more slot machines, table games and restaurants. A hotel is also on the works and is due to open in May 2013.

“I just can’t wait,” marketing director Arlene Alleman told 5 News. It’s just really a beautiful casino. I think that people will really be surprised at just how luxurious it is.”

The tribe is adding more than 350 jobs with the expansion of the casino. Pocola is a few miles from the Arkansas border.
